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Beckenham Hill to Horton-in-Ribblesdale start from as little as £38.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Beckenham Hill to Horton-in-Ribblesdale start from £82.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Beckenham Hill to Horton-in-Ribblesdale are available for £182.60 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Beckenham Hill Station is outfitted with everything you need to simplify your travel experience. It offers facilities such as ticket machines and smartcard services, ensuring a seamless process for purchasing and collecting your train tickets. With an operational ticket office from Monday to Friday between 6:40 AM and 1:20 PM, travelers have reliable access to in-person assistance should they need it.

Services and Facilities

The station is equipped with step-free access, catering to passengers with mobility challenges. While there is no waiting room, there is a seating area available. Customers can find help points conveniently located on the platforms, available around the clock. Staff assistance is on hand during weekdays to help you navigate your journey smoothly. It's important to plan ahead, as there are no public restrooms, refreshment options, or Wi-Fi available on-site.

Travel Connections

Beckenham Hill Station is well-connected to additional transport modes. If your plan involves hopping onto a bus, you’ll find a map detailing onward travel options within the station premises. For those departures that may require a rail replacement service, such information is also readily accessible. Though there are no facilities for cycle hire, bicycle stands are available for those riding to the station, protected by CCTV for your peace of mind.

Facilities at Horton-in-Ribblesdale Station

One of the quaint features about Horton-in-Ribblesdale is its simplicity. The station l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, so it’s useful to purchase tickets in advance or online before arriving. For day-trippers concerned about accessibility, it's important to note that step-free access is challenging with steep step-ups to the train, although ramps are available with help from the train conductor.

Although you won’t find shops or refreshment facilities directly at the station, the village offers charming local options for a snack or meal. If you need assistance, there are customer help points, but bear in mind there are no staff on site at the station. Likewise, the lack of CCTV on platforms and parking means your personal vigilance adds to the tranquillity of this rural setting.

Onward Travel from Horton-in-Ribblesdale Station

Getting around from Horton-in-Ribblesdale can be an adventure on its own. For road transport, you might have to rely on local taxi services which can be found through resources like Cab4You. The station's position on popular trekking routes makes taxi and bus lines handy, although directly linked buses are limited and require checking beforehand.

Bicycle enthusiasts can park bikes securely at the station, though bicycle hire isn't currently available on-site, so plan accordingly if you wish to cycle through the picturesque landscape.
